JQUERY PEQUEÑO CORRECTO LA OPCIÓN DE SELECCION DE FUNCIÓN -- javascript campo con php campo con jquery campo con mysql camp Relacionados El problema

Jquery little correct the function select option


1
vote

problema

Español

La función para seleccionar opciones para (país - & gt; región - & gt; ciudad)

Todo el trabajo bueno Cuando el usuario fue registro, pero después de esto, si el usuario necesita correcto y cambie su región o ciudad (por país seleccionado ), su DOS no muestra las opciones de selección con regiones. Para mostrar, el usuario necesita cambiar a otro país y volver a su país para ver la región Seleccionar y ciudades al final.

Aquí muestro el ejemplo del problema http://jsfiddle.net/nazaret2005/bpubb/ Con el país de EE. UU. Seleccionado.

aquí es jQuery (del ejemplo de URL)

      $(document).ready(function () {      $('#Main').change(function () {         var a1 = $("#Main").val();         var a2 = $(".Subselect").val();         console.log(a1);         console.log(a2);         $(".Subselect").hide();         $(".lastSel").hide();         $("#" + a1).show();         $.ajax({             type: "POST",             url: "/ajax_city.php",             data: {                     "country": a1,                     "region": a2             },             success: function (data) {                 $(".region").html(data);                 $(".Subselect").show();             }         });     });      $('.Subselect').change(function () {         var a3 = $(this).val();         console.log(a3);         $(".lastSel").hide();         $("#" + a3).show();         $.ajax({             type: "POST",             url: "/ajax_city.php",             data: {                     "city": a3             },             success: function (data) {                 $(".region").html(data);                 $(".Subselect").show();             }         });     }); });   

y aquí pequeño código diferente con PHP / MYSQL, JQERY y CSS https: //www.dropbox .com / sh / i5ku2ld65c774bo / jgaqfxtnbk (en ruso)

P.s.: Muestro el ejemplo del código que no aquí (porque el código no es corto) y lo siento por mi inglés. Gracias por la ayuda.

Original en ingles

The function to select options for (Country --> Region --> City)

All work good when the user was registration, but after this, if user need correct and change his region or city (By country selected), its dosn't show the SELECT Options with Regions. To show, user need change to another country and back to him country for see the region select and cities in the end.

Here i show the EXAMPLE of the problem http://jsfiddle.net/Nazaret2005/bPUbb/ with USA country selected.

Here is Jquery (from the url example)

    $(document).ready(function () {      $('#Main').change(function () {         var a1 = $("#Main").val();         var a2 = $(".Subselect").val();         console.log(a1);         console.log(a2);         $(".Subselect").hide();         $(".lastSel").hide();         $("#" + a1).show();         $.ajax({             type: "POST",             url: "/ajax_city.php",             data: {                     "country": a1,                     "region": a2             },             success: function (data) {                 $(".region").html(data);                 $(".Subselect").show();             }         });     });      $('.Subselect').change(function () {         var a3 = $(this).val();         console.log(a3);         $(".lastSel").hide();         $("#" + a3).show();         $.ajax({             type: "POST",             url: "/ajax_city.php",             data: {                     "city": a3             },             success: function (data) {                 $(".region").html(data);                 $(".Subselect").show();             }         });     }); }); 

And here little different code with php/mysql,jquery and css https://www.dropbox.com/sh/i5ku2ld65c774bo/JgAqFXTnbK (In russian)

P.S.: I show the example of the code not here (because code not short) And sorry for my english. Thanks for help.

           

Lista de respuestas

2
 
vote
vote
La mejor respuesta
 

editado

Pruebe este código Actualice el código este enlace . Llame al evento de cambio dinámicamente.

   $('#Main').change();   
 

Edited

Try this code i updated the code this link. Call change event dynamically.

 $('#Main').change(); 
 
 
   
   

Relacionados problema

1  MySQL: Consultas de migración de V4 a V5  ( Mysql migrating queries from v4 to v5 ) 
Al migrar un proyecto de MySQL 4 a MySQL 5, ¿cuáles son las cosas principales que necesito para abordar para garantizar que las consultas siguen siendo compat...

191  Datos binarios en MySQL [CERRADO]  ( Binary data in mysql ) 
cerrado . Esta pregunta debe ser más enfocado . Actualmente no está aceptando respuestas. ...

88  Cómo exportar datos de SQL Server 2005 a MySQL [CERRADO]  ( How to export data from sql server 2005 to mysql ) 
cerrado. Esta pregunta es off-topic . Actualmente no está aceptando respuestas. ¿Quieres ...

177  Tirar un error en un gatillo MySQL  ( Throw an error in a mysql trigger ) 
Si tengo un M_PI3 M_PI4 en una tabla, ¿cómo puedo lanzar un error que evita la actualización en esa tabla? ...

87  SQL Server 2005 Implementación de MySQL Reemplazar en?  ( Sql server 2005 implementation of mysql replace into ) 
MySQL tiene este comando increíblemente útil y propietario 99887776611 SQL. ¿Se puede emular fácilmente en SQL Server 2005? Inicio de una nueva transacc...

0  Las pruebas unitarias de rieles fallan debido a una restricción única en Schema_Migrations  ( Rails unit tests fail because of unique constraint on schema migrations ) 
Estoy tratando de ejecutar rake test:units y sigo recibiendo esto: Mysql::Error: Duplicate entry '2147483647' for key 1: INSERT INTO `ts_schema_migration...

39  Python y MySQL  ( Python and mysql ) 
Puedo conseguir que Python funcione con PostgreSQL, pero no puedo hacer que funcione con MySQL. El problema principal es que, en la cuenta de alojamiento comp...

317  ¿Qué tan grande puede obtener una base de datos MySQL antes de que se inicie el rendimiento para degradarse?  ( How big can a mysql database get before performance starts to degrade ) 
¿En qué punto comienza a perder una base de datos MySQL? significa el tamaño de la base de datos física? ¿Cuántos registros importan? ¿Alguna degradaci...

136  Mecanismos para el seguimiento de cambios de esquema DB [CERRADO]  ( Mechanisms for tracking db schema changes ) 
Según lo que actualmente representa, esta pregunta no es un buen ajuste para nuestro Q & Amp; un formato. Esperamos que las...

2  Uniéndose 2 columnas de Table1 a la Tabla 2  ( Joining 2 columns from table1 to table 2 ) 
¿Cómo se hace referencia a la tabla1 columnas a 2 columnas en la Tabla 2 He creado una tabla ' estado ' con 50 filas exactas Tratando de relacionar (Estad...




© 2022 respuesta.top Reservados todos los derechos. Centro de preguntas y respuestas reservados todos los derechos